Mayhem of the Moving Mollusk is the fourth episode of the third season of A Pup Named Scooby-Doo, and the twenty-fifth episode overall in the series.
Premise
When the high-tech monster catching group "Critter Getters" breaks up, the remaining member wants the gang to restore her reputation for her, by helping catch the Moving Mollusk, a snail monster terrorizing New York City.

Notes/trivia
- This is the first and only case to be set outside of Coolsville.
- The Daily Blab could be a reference to the Daily Babbler.
- Unlike other season 3 episodes, this one and the next shows the title card directly after the theme song.
Animation mistakes and/or technical glitches
- After the Moving Mollusk is launched off the turnstile on to the train and it leaves, the second track, the other subway platform, and the city backdrop are all missing.
- When Lester Leonard is shown appearing to catch the Mollusk, Scooby and the gang are positioned inconsistently from the background. They are undersized and appear to be floating above the ground.
